Theoretical Diagnostics of Second and Third-order Hyperpolarizabilities of Several Acid Derivatives
The density functional theory (DFT) at B3LYP/ 6-31G(d) level has been utilized to achieve the electric dipole moment (μ), static dipole polarizability (α) and first hyperpolarizability (β) values for ferulic acid (1) and chenodeoxycholic acid (2).
